				<text><![CDATA[This cast is ambitious as all hell.   They try several different experimental techniques, and don't fail at any of them. <br><br>I'm not sure if it is wise to allow the audience to control the story, but I admire the hell out of someone with the courage to try. <br><br>As mentioned below, the cast is large and complex, the plot threads are complex - particulary with the "choose your own" technique.  <br><br>Unfortunately the center is missing. The story isn't strong enough to support all the experimental techniques.   Prisoners surprised by the notion that they are being monitored in prison.  Galactic galahads funded and equipped to compete with planetary opponents.  The net effect is to leave me with a suspicion of Costikyan's "plucky little England" syndrome - that the protagonists are heroes cause they have a special relationship with the writers. Unlike the villians they don't have to pay mortgages, answer to higher authorities, make moral compromises, or poop twice a day.  ]]></text>
